Three tutorials 02..., 03... and 04_... all still use a PauliSumOp. Since the H2_op started out as a SparsePauliOp I am not sure why its later converted to a PauliSumOp. In the case of 03 that may be as it still is using the deprecated NumPyMinimumEigensolver. These uses lead to deprecated messages in the tutorials so they need to be updated accordingly.
